1. Classic Everest Base Camp (EBC) Trek
Route: Lukla → Namche → EBC → Kala Patthar - same trail back to Lukla
Duration: 12 days (You need 15 days in average including arrival & departure days in Kathmandu)
Difficulty: Moderate to Challenging
Distance: ~130 km (round trip)
Highlights:
Kala Patthar (5,545m) for the best Everest view
Tengboche Monastery (largest in Khumbu)
Sherpa culture throughout the trails
Day. | Route | Distance|Duration | Altitude gain | Loss |
1 | Kathmandu - lukla - Phakding (2860m) | 40min flight +8KM trek | +1500m, - 250m |
2 | Phakdin - Namche (3440m) | 12Km- 6 hours Trek | +800m |
3 | Acclimatization in Namche (Hike to Everest View Hotel | 4Km - 3 hours Trek | +400m |
4 | Namche → Tengboche (3,860m) | 10KM - 6 hours Trek | +420m |
5 | Tengboche → Dingboche (4,410m) | 12KM - 6 hours Trek | +550m |
6 | Acclimatization in Dingboche (Hike to Nangkartshang Peak) | 5Km - 5 hours Trek | +600m |
7 | Dingboche → Lobuche (4,940m) | 8KM - 6 hours Trek | +530m |
8 | Lobuche → Gorak Shep (5,170m) → EBC (5,364m) | 12KM - 8 hours Trek | +230m |
9 | Gorak Shep → Kala Patthar (5,545m) → Pheriche (4,240m) | 14KM - 8 hours Trek | +370m |
10 | Pheriche → Namche Bazaar | 20KM - 6 hours Trek | -1200m |
11 | Namche → Lukla | 18KM - 8 hours Trek | -580m |
12 | Fly Lukla → Kathmandu | 35min flight | -1500m |
